I gave an AI agent access to a cable modem, a serial console, Ghidra, and a custom GDB stub, then asked it to reverse the firmware and hunt for bugs. It re-discovered known vulnerabilities, found new ones, and wrote working exploits. This post covers the setup, what it managed to do on its own, and where I still had to step in. The real problem is that the same approach now works on millions of devices nobody plans to fix.

Researchers at the University of Toronto's Continuum Robotics Laboratory introduced CRAFT, a 3D-printed modular design library for tendon-driven continuum robots that allows a single robot to physically reconfigure its shape, stiffness, and degrees of freedom within minutes by snapping together six interchangeable modules. The same base robot was reconfigured into a long teleoperated probe for aircraft-wing inspection achieving 41% reduction in sag, a pipe-crawling robot capable of navigating 90-degree bends and 30-degree inclines, and a soft robotic hand that successfully cracked eggs with 85% accuracy. CRAFT eliminates the need to build entirely new robots for different tasks, replacing bespoke redesign with rapid modular composition.
